interface MultiQueryRetrieverInput {
    llmChain: LLMChain<LineList, LLMType>;
    retriever: BaseRetrieverInterface<Record<string, any>>;
    documentCompressor?: BaseDocumentCompressor;
    documentCompressorFilteringFn?: ((docs) => MultiDocs);
    parserKey?: string;
    queryCount?: number;
}

Hierarchy

  • BaseRetrieverInput
    • MultiQueryRetrieverInput

Properties

llmChain: LLMChain<LineList, LLMType>
retriever: BaseRetrieverInterface<Record<string, any>>
documentCompressor?: BaseDocumentCompressor
documentCompressorFilteringFn?: ((docs) => MultiDocs)

Type declaration

parserKey?: string
queryCount?: number

Generated using TypeDoc